Finnigan's Story

Finnigan came to us when his owner moved into a nursing home. He is familiar with a calm household, without young children or canines. He is an outgoing boy who does enjoy attention from his adult human friends, and loves a good lap to curl up on. He loves a good scratching post, and a cozy bed to sleep on. Finnigan was familiar with an indoor/outdoor lifestyle, and may want to continue that in his next home, but it is not a requirement. In his previous home he did not live with any felines, and here at the shelter he seemed to be a bit of a bully with his shy feline roommates, so with any other cats in a new home, he would need a very slow introduction to make sure it's a good match.
